<dcvalue element="description" qualifier="abstract">We&#x20;demonstrate&#x20;a&#x20;novel&#x20;kind&#x20;of&#x20;tunable&#x20;optical&#x20;delays&#x20;based&#x20;on&#x20;dynamic&#x20;grating&#x20;generated&#x20;by&#x20;Brillouin&#x20;scattering&#x20;in&#x20;an&#x20;optical&#x20;fiber.&#x20;An&#x20;axial&#x20;strain&#x20;gradient&#x20;is&#x20;applied&#x20;to&#x20;a&#x20;15&#x20;m&#x20;section&#x20;of&#x20;a&#x20;polarization-maintaining&#x20;fiber,&#x20;and&#x20;the&#x20;Brillouin&#x20;reflection&#x20;grating&#x20;is&#x20;generated&#x20;position-selectively&#x20;by&#x20;controlling&#x20;the&#x20;optical&#x20;frequencies&#x20;of&#x20;Brillouin&#x20;pump&#x20;waves.&#x20;Tunable&#x20;time&#x20;delays&#x20;of&#x20;up&#x20;to&#x20;132&#x20;ns&#x20;are&#x20;achieved&#x20;with&#x20;an&#x20;82&#x20;ns&#x20;Gaussian&#x20;pulse.&#x20;(c)&#x20;2009&#x20;Optical&#x20;Society&#x20;of&#x20;America</dcvalue>
